Abstract

The definition of information is investigated both in general context and in relation to journalism. The concept of «information» is considered from the point of view of various scientific theories, the authors of which are, including authoritative foreign sociologists and philosophers. Emphasis is placed on such concepts as news and infotainment. The main sociocultural functions of the infotainment are considered, as well as the main criteria characterizing the notion «news information».
